Marketing Your Business

Every business needs to get the word out. And every business needs to continue to get the word out. Depending on your industry, target market, and budget, you can devise an effective marketing strategy that works many fronts – both online and off – to reach customers.

Create a Marketing Plan

Your first stop will be to develop a marketing plan. Because market conditions are constantly changing, having this roadmap will guide you when you need to adjust your course. As with the business plan, getting specific about your marketing goals can help you make decisions about your business. Using Press Releases

Once you are open for business, or have a newsworthy announcement, a well-crafted press release can help attract media attention. Low-cost or even free (if you write it yourself), press releases should also be posted on your website in service of search engine marketing (SEM).

Online Business Promotion

Speaking of SEM, online promotion is increasingly a must-have ingredient in any marketing mix. As consumers spend more time on the Internet, so will the companies that want to reach them. But it doesn’t have to be through annoying, flashing pop-up ads. A lot of SEM is about creating an online presence and shaping your company’s image through two-way communication with consumers.

Offline Business Promotion

And of course there’s offline business promotion, often referred to as “traditional” advertising. First of all, traditional advertising isn’t always, well, traditional. And even when it is, it can be very effective. Print and broadcast ads can reinforce each other’s message, capture attention, and direct consumers to you, virtually or literally.
